Steering tweaks (#14140)

- Fix the direct-path so NPCs. This is most noticeable when moving diagonally on planetmaps (given the current pathfinder is cardinal)
- Reduce static collision avoidance weight and distance. This seems to reduce instances of getting stuck on railings.
